#6c4484 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6c4484 is composed of 42.4% red, 26.7%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.2% cyan, 48.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 277.5 degrees, a saturation of 32% and a lightness of 39.2%. #6c4484 color hex could be obtained by blending #d888ff with #000009.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#6c4484 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6c4484 has RGB values of R:108, G:68, B:132 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0.48, Y:0,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 7095428.

Shades and Tints of #6c4484
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020103 is the darkest color, while #f8f5f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#6c4484
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646365 is the less saturated color, while #7b06c2 is the most saturated one.
